Facilities ticket — Halewick Tower, night shift.

Issue: support team reporting east stairwell reader rejecting badges after midnight. Reader was reset this morning; firmware updated. Overnight crew should now badge as normal. If the reader fails again, use the manual keypad by the fire door — do not prop the door. Log any further failures with the time and badge name. Temporary keypad code for the fallback door is below.

door code, tajeg-fawip: bdg-K-62

// Debounce delay (ms) for the Streetwick address autocomplete widget.
// Below 200ms the suggestion service rate-limits us during peak checkout
// traffic; above 350ms users report the dropdown feels laggy. Keep in
// sync with the mobile constant in autocomplete_native.ts. Current value
// was benchmarked against the following build.

trace token, tawep-fahif: htk3_b58

# Fixture: driver-assignment heuristic (Cartwheel Dispatch)
# The heuristic scores drivers by proximity, shift remaining, and
# recent decline rate, then picks the top score with a 10% random
# jitter to avoid starvation. This fixture pins the RNG seed so
# assignments are deterministic across runs — don't remove the seed
# or downstream snapshot tests break. The fixture also calls the live
# staging scorer once to verify schema compatibility, and that call
# must authenticate. Use the staging token below.

portal login ticket: eyJhbGciOiJIUzI1NiIsInR5cCI6IkpXVCJ9.eyJzdWIiOiIwEOsktwVNwIn0.-UJU3fdyyCgG